From aee2c99d29a0dd3d01eb477c8bfa0f175ff4bd71 Mon Sep 17 00:00:00 2001 From: jiangping <jp@doumee.com> Date: 星期五, 15 十二月 2023 14:47:47 +0800 Subject: [PATCH] 海康接口对接开发 --- server/dmvisit_service/src/main/java/com/doumee/service/business/ERPSyncService.java | 20 +++++++++++++------- 1 files changed, 13 insertions(+), 7 deletions(-) diff --git a/server/dmvisit_service/src/main/java/com/doumee/service/business/ERPSyncService.java b/server/dmvisit_service/src/main/java/com/doumee/service/business/ERPSyncService.java index f2802b8..c87d6f1 100644 --- a/server/dmvisit_service/src/main/java/com/doumee/service/business/ERPSyncService.java +++ b/server/dmvisit_service/src/main/java/com/doumee/service/business/ERPSyncService.java @@ -1,14 +1,13 @@ package com.doumee.service.business; +import com.doumee.core.erp.model.openapi.request.erp.*; +import com.doumee.core.erp.model.openapi.response.erp.ApproveInfoResponse; import com.doumee.core.haikang.model.param.request.AcsDeviceListRequest; import com.doumee.core.haikang.model.param.request.PrivilegeGroupRequest; import com.doumee.core.model.PageData; import com.doumee.core.model.PageWrap; -import com.doumee.core.model.openapi.request.*; -import com.doumee.core.model.openapi.request.erp.OrgListRequest; -import com.doumee.core.model.openapi.request.erp.UserInfoRequest; -import com.doumee.core.model.openapi.request.erp.UserListRequest; -import com.doumee.core.model.openapi.response.*; +import com.doumee.core.erp.model.openapi.request.*; +import com.doumee.core.erp.model.openapi.response.*; import java.util.List; @@ -18,6 +17,12 @@ * @date 2023/11/30 15:33 */ public interface ERPSyncService { + + /** + * 鍔犺浇榛樿鍙傛暟 + * @return + */ + int initHkConfig(); /** * 鍚屾ERP缁勭粐淇℃伅 * @param param @@ -33,12 +38,13 @@ String syncUsers(UserListRequest param); + /** - * 鑾峰彇ERP浜哄憳淇℃伅 + * 鎻愪氦鐢ㄦ埛鍚屾澶辫触璁板綍 * @param param * @return */ - String syncUserInfo(UserInfoRequest param); + boolean noticeUserFail(UserFailRequest param); /** -- Gitblit v1.9.3